6 years ago I went to a doctor for a bump on my nose. The DX was a deep vein under the skin, no biopsy. 6 years later I went to Schweitzer Dermatology, appointment with Dr. Albridge, she walked into the room and immediately said I have basal cell ca. but needed to biopsy it to be sure of her DX and Mohs surgery was recommended. Three weeks later I had Mohs surgery with Dr Arzeno MD. She was absolutely wonderful. The surgery was quick and painless. Now, one week after surgery, my nose is on its way to recovery and looks good. This institute is well run and the doctors, nurses and support staff are all professionals that get results and make you feel welcome. I’d recommend this organization to all my friends and family to alleviate what I went through 6 years ago.
